`THUMBO_CONCURRENCY` controls parallel renders (default 4; do not exceed 8 on the Karsk tier). `THUMBO_SOURCE_BUCKET` must match the ingest bucket exactly, including region suffix. Release managers should verify every variable against the deploy checklist before promoting a build. Finally, the queue broker's authentication credential is set on the line immediately following this one.

env line for tawig-kadup: VAULT_KEY5=07c4f

# Break-Glass: Quillon Session Refresh Bug

Scope: emergency access when the Quillon gateway's token-refresh bug locks out all operator sessions. Preconditions: incident declared, two approvers on record. Procedure: disable the refresh daemon, connect via the Harrowfield bastion, restore sessions from the signed snapshot. Reviewer note — break-glass use is logged immutably and reviewed within 24 hours. The bastion's break-glass account is unlocked with the passphrase kept immediately below for auditability.

strongbox words: gilok-druion-briath-wendor-briion-prawyn-fenion-oliir-casdor-holius-briius-gilath-gilael-pelys

## Changelog — 3.2.1

Key rotation release. No functional changes.

- Parity: Sparkmill JS SDK now matches the Kotlin SDK on batch upload, retry semantics, and offline queue APIs. Remaining gaps tracked for 3.3.
- Rotation: the plugin-signing key used by 3.1.x expires at end of month. Plugins signed with the old key will fail verification after cutoff.
- Action: rebuild and re-sign plugins against the new key, provided below.

deploy key for yajop-fahop: bky3_h1v